|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ard cutting tools without proper cooling and lubrication, leading to work hardening and reduced tool life. | Employ carbide or high-speed steel tooling with copious amounts of coolant and lubricant, and utilize slower feed rates and appropriate speeds. |
| Inadequate weld preparation, resulting in porosity or contamination of the weld joint. | Thoroughly clean the weld area to remove all surface contaminants, and utilize inert gas shielding (e.g., Argon) during welding to prevent oxidation. |
